Glendalough is an extraordinary place not only for its historical places, but also and especially for its naturalistic treasures, which can be easily discovered by walking one of the many hiking trails in the area. Here we show you the "red route".
moderate
Distance 13.5 km
The "red trail" runs from the Wicklow Mountains National Park Visitor Center up the mountainside surrounding Upper Lake and returns downstream on the opposite side of the lake. To this official trail, we added the round trip from and to the Visitor center in Glendalough. The trail is generally well maintained and of medium difficulty because of the elevation and a couple of more exposed sections. Please note that in strong winds walking the narrow wooden planks can become complicated and require extra caution.
